Majorstuen are a young band scraping up a storm with their unique Norweigan roots sound. They have refined their vast musical dialects to a single, personal and playful common language.  All perform on the fiddle, occasionally trading off on cello or viola. Majorstuen have released three successful albums, and were awarded the Norwegian Grammy in 2003 for their debut album. In 2005 they were appointed "Folk Musicians of the Year" by the Norwegian Concert Institute.  Majorstuen have, since 2001 been touring in Norway, Germany, France, Spain, Slovenia, Azerbaijan, Israel and Canada, including performances at F?rde International Folk Music Festival, Bergen International Festival, Festival d'Ile de France, Celtic Colours and TFF.Rudolstadt. 

"This young and creative collective succeeds in utilising the totality of artistic ingredients within the Norwegian musical heritage, thus producing breathtaking new perspectives." Music Information Centre, Norway.
